YP03 HJD is a 2003 Renault Kangoo in Red with a 1,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2003 Renault Kangoo models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.5% with a typical mileage of 78,369 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Renault Kangoo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 86,705 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YP03 HJD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Kangoo typ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 23 years old, this Renault Kangoo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
